Shot in high definition
on the Mississippi Gulf Coast, featuring never-before-seen
storm footage, and scored with an original blues-rock soundtrack
composed and
performed
by
Katrina survivors, Mississippi
Son (95 min.) tells
the heartwrenching and heartwarming story of the people,
the
culture, and the
future in
the wake
of Hurricane
Katrina.
Born and raised in Gulfport, Mississippi, Emmy award winning L.A. filmmaker
Don Wilson was deeply moved by the losses of his friends and family. In this
film, he returns
home
to
talk to those who lived through the hurricane and continue to deal with the
aftermath
of
the
storm.
While the media has been focused on New
Orleans, Mississippi Son reminds us that the Mississippi
Gulf Coast was completely destroyed by Hurricane Katrina. We
made this film to give a voice to the people who have been
neglected by the media, FEMA, SBA, and the insurance companies
as billions continue to pour into the war in Iraq.
We would like to extend special thanks
to The Edge and Music Rising along with the Grammy's MusiCares.
The soundtrack was recorded with instruments bought with
grants from these two generous organizations dedicated to
helping musicians, especially those who lost everything in
the storm.
